When you call, we look at several things to help pin down your rates. Insurance carriers weigh your current age, your location, and your overall health history. Your choice of deductible is another big factor; picking a higher one often lowers your monthly payment, while a lower deductible keeps your out-of-pocket costs down if you need care. Your specific coverage needs—like how often you visit a doctor or if you need prescription drug help—also shift the final amount. Short-term health insurance in Elgin offers temporary coverage, typically for a few months, and is designed to bridge gaps in coverage. These plans generally do not cover pre-existing conditions or essential health benefits as comprehensively as ACA-compliant plans. The cost of health insurance in Elgin varies significantly based on the plan tier (Bronze, Silver, Gold, Platinum), your age, income, and location. Higher-tier plans generally have higher premiums but lower out-of-pocket costs, while lower-tier plans are more affordable monthly but cost more when you use services.
